Tor Milde (born January 14, 1953 – died January 15, 2014) was a well-known Norwegian journalist and writer. He was especially famous for his work as a music journalist. Many people also knew him as a judge on the popular TV music show Idol in Norway. He appeared on the show in 2005 and 2006.
Who Was Tor Milde?
Tor Milde was born in Oslo, the capital city of Norway. He began his career in journalism in 1984. This means he started writing for newspapers and magazines. He spent many years sharing his thoughts and opinions with readers.
His Career in Music
Tor Milde became very well known for writing about music. He was a music journalist and a critic. A music critic writes reviews and shares opinions about new songs, albums, and artists. He worked for a major Norwegian newspaper called Verdens Gang, often called VG. Through his writing, he helped people discover new music and understand different artists.
Being an Idol Judge
One of his most public roles was being a judge on Idol. This TV show helps find new singing talent. As a judge, Tor Milde gave feedback to contestants. He helped decide who would move forward in the competition. This made him a familiar face to many TV viewers across Norway.
His Later Life
Tor Milde passed away on January 15, 2014, when he was 61 years old. He died in his hometown of Oslo after a short illness. He is remembered by his two sons and his girlfriend, Irja Anthi.
